The House of Commons lately made the subject of debate:
Whose qualities each Member vied with each to numerate,
And what their fancy painted him I’ll now proceed to state;
’Tis the fine young English Officer, as he is to be—in time.
His head so old on shoulders young with knowledge overflows,
Acquaintance with all sciences and arts its stores disclose,
All books and in all languages by heart almost he knows,
And he’s able to write legibly, and what is more, compose:
Like a wise young English Officer, the reason of my rhyme.
